ThreadPool Android гэж юу вэ?
ThreadPool Android гэж юу вэ?

Видео: ThreadPool Android гэж юу вэ?

Видео: ThreadPool Android гэж юу вэ?
Видео: Java урок - 19.3.1 Многопоточность. Thread Pool. Executors 2024, Арваннэгдүгээр
Anonim

Ашиглах Thread Pool in Android . Утасны сан нь бүлэг ажилчны хэлхээтэй нэг FIFO ажлын дараалал юм. Үйлдвэрлэгчид (жишээ нь, UI утас) даалгавруудыг ажлын дараалал руу илгээдэг. Ямар ч ажилчин утас руу орох бүрт утас сан бэлэн болсон үед тэд дарааллын урд талын даалгавруудыг устгаад ажиллуулж эхэлнэ.

Үүний дагуу Android дээр HandlerThread гэж юу вэ?

↳ Android .os. HandlerThread . Looper-тэй Thread. Дараа нь Looper-ийг Handler s үүсгэхэд ашиглаж болно. Энгийн Thread, Thread-тай адил гэдгийг анхаарна уу.

Цаашилбал, thread pool гэж юу вэ, яагаад үүнийг ашигладаг вэ? А утас сан ажилчдын цуглуулга юм утаснууд програмын нэрийн өмнөөс асинхрон дуудлагыг үр дүнтэй гүйцэтгэдэг. The утас сан юуны түрүүнд ашигласан өргөдлийн тоог багасгах утаснууд мөн ажилтны удирдлагаар хангах утаснууд.

Java хэл дээрх ThreadPool гэж юу болохыг бас мэдэх үү?

Java Thread сан нь ажлыг хүлээж, олон удаа дахин ашиглах ажилчдын хэлхээг төлөөлдөг. Тохиолдолд утас сан , тогтмол хэмжээтэй утаснуудын бүлэг үүсгэгддэг. -аас авсан утас утас сан үйлчилгээ үзүүлэгчээс татаж аваад ажилд томилдог.

Android ExecutorService гэж юу вэ?

Нэг буюу хэд хэдэн асинхрон даалгаврын явцыг хянах Ирээдүйг бий болгох, дуусгавар болгох арга, аргуудыг хангадаг Гүйцэтгэгч. Ан Гүйцэтгэгч үйлчилгээ хаах боломжтой бөгөөд энэ нь шинэ ажлуудаас татгалзахад хүргэдэг.

Зөвлөмж болгож буй: